Unlike corded drills that rely on motor amperage, the power in cordless drills depends on the battery voltage. Drills that come with high voltage batteries deliver more torque, which is the turning power applied on the drill bits. Some of the powerful cordless drills support 18 to 20 volts batteries. Corded drills are generally more powerful, leaner, and lighter than their cordless cousins. However, they’re noisier, less convenient, and your mobility is restricted. Cordless drills on the other hand are irreplaceably convenient, yet are bulky, heavy tools with a limited lifespan and obvious power restrictions. While similar to regular cordless drills in most respects, cordless impact drivers tend to be smaller, lighter and more powerful than the former. Most models also substitute the standard keyless chuck with a hex drive system, a special quick-release mechanism that takes only hex-shanked driver bits.
